Output 598e3bfcffcc59f43e3b65dd2ca0f1ad959ed051c28ee61352cb018499e46b87:2

value
1379601
script pubkey
OP_0 OP_PUSHBYTES_20 b6680b0fe2bc00ebc5defd8d55a3fc53c4baf58c
address
bc1qke5qkrlzhsqwh3w7lkx4tglu20zt4avvaax77e
transaction
598e3bfcffcc59f43e3b65dd2ca0f1ad959ed051c28ee61352cb018499e46b87
spent
true